Web13 nov. 2024 · To determine if your rain gutters sag, check for signs of standing water or water marks along the inner sides of the gutters. Using a bubble level, check the slope—gutters should drop about 1/4 inch for every 10 feet of run toward the downspouts. Web21 jul. 2024 · Choose a self-adhesive patch for PVC gutters or small holes. Self-adhesive, flexible gutter repair patches are a good short-term fix choice for holes less than 1 in (2.5 cm) in diameter, regardless of the material your gutters are made of. They’re also the best choice if you have PVC gutters, no matter the size of the hole.

Web15 okt. 2024 · Many gutter issues, such as alignment and slope, are easy to fix. A gutter specialist will charge, on average, $188 for basic gutter repairs, with upcharges added to the bill as the project gets more complicated. Homeowners looking to save money may want to consider doing their realignment or paying a handyman instead of a specialist to do the ...
